Fire in garage and ice factory in Nadda, capital under control
A fire broke out in a garage and ice factory in Nadda, capital. The fire was brought under control after about an hour and a half with the efforts of 6 units of the fire service. According to local and eyewitness sources, the fire broke out at 5:30 am today, Wednesday (February 25).
No casualties were reported in the fire. However, the cars in the garage were burnt in the fire. In addition, a part of a nearby multi-storey building was damaged in the heat of the fire. So far, nothing is known about the origin of the fire. However, traffic in the area slowed down after the fire broke out. Although the fire was brought under control, there was a jam across the entire road, but now traffic on the road is normal.
